Google Gets Smarter All the Time
To figure out how to give its search users better results, Google is constantly improving its system. In the past, repeating a keyword was enough to rank a page. You might have heard of this process as “keyword stuffing.”
Google got better at understanding what the words around the main keyword meant as it got smarter. If you want to get better results, don’t stuff a page with the same keyword over and over again. Primary and Secondary Keywords
Your page should focus on a main keyword and a few additional keywords for SEO to work well. The post’s main topic serves as the primary keyword. A searcher would use these words in Google.
Secondary keywords help Google figure out what the page is really about by linking to the main keywords.
Let’s look at the keyword “lose weight.” The keyword “lose weight” could refer to exercise, a race car, gear, or various other topics. If the page includes words like diet, running, cardio, and scale, then fitness is likely its subject.
If you want to rank for “lose weight” on that page of your site, using all of those other keywords will help your SEO by telling Google what the page is about. You will also have a better chance of ranking for searches like “weight loss diet” or “best cardio for losing weight.”

Don’t Get Too Caught Up With Keywords
Keywords are important for websites, but don’t worry too much about them. Please write clearly and ensure that visitors to your site can easily find useful information. Put your keywords in places where they make sense, but don’t make the writing weird or hard to read just to put them in.
Focusing on quality will also help with SEO because Google wants to give its searchers the best possible answer for their needs. If you learn how to do keyword study right, more people will visit your website.
